Family HealthCare Center is a private, 501(c)(3) non-profit community health center providing medical, dental, pharmacy, and lab services to the Fargo-Moorhead area. We served just over 13,000 individual patients in 2009.
Our main clinic is located at 306 4th St. N., in Fargo. We also have a dental clinic at 715 11th St. N. in Moorhead and our Homeless Health Services clinic in the basement of St. Mark’s Lutheran Church, 670 4th Ave. N. in Fargo. We provide education services to help patients manage conditions such as diabetes and hypertension. We also provide referrals to mental health services in the community. As a community health center, Family HealthCare Center provides services to patients regardless of ability to pay. Fees are adjusted based on the patient’s income and family size. At least 51% of our governing board members are patients representing the population we serve.
